Honey-coated peanuts contain 510 calories per 100 g. The same serving provides 15.5 g of protein, 44 g of carbohydrates, and 32 g of fat.
Honey-coated peanuts are compatible with Mediterranean, vegetarian, flexitarian, and omnivore diets. They are processed and contain peanuts, so they are not suitable for people with peanut allergies.
